peter
|
7c0b6e129e
* fixed wrong typecasts
|
21 years ago |
peter
|
6458bd0ce1
* tvarsym splitted
|
21 years ago |
florian
|
7b8c44bbce
* fixed open arrays when using register variables
|
21 years ago |
peter
|
79e754cb8c
forgot if cs_debuginfo
|
21 years ago |
peter
|
f4a7c3d444
fixed debuginfo for variables in staticsymtable
|
21 years ago |
peter
|
c95a859f0a
* generic tlocation
|
21 years ago |
olle
|
51fb338952
* reverted, for macos only, last change.
|
21 years ago |
peter
|
ed07ab5f04
* localloc of staticsymtable needs a AT_NONE since it is a reference
|
21 years ago |
peter
|
705868e816
* remove saveregister calling convention
|
21 years ago |
peter
|
adb6f59eef
* small regvar fixes
|
21 years ago |
mazen
|
581b52422c
- remove $IFDEF DELPHI and related code
|
21 years ago |
peter
|
a4c5a55d1b
* add reg_sync when regvars are allocated to fix first use in
|
21 years ago |
peter
|
60c73cc0e5
* -Or fixes for open array
|
21 years ago |
peter
|
66df745917
* small regvar for para fixes
|
21 years ago |
peter
|
4f7667488b
* parameter regvar fixes
|
21 years ago |
peter
|
d6bffaf5c6
* fixed sparc compile
|
21 years ago |
peter
|
b0c25b50a0
* symtable allocation rewritten
|
21 years ago |
olle
|
d87707fc6c
* Refs to DEBUGINFO_<x> is now not inserted for target MacOS
|
21 years ago |
florian
|
016f2e9b15
* fixed storage of parameters passed by ref.
|
21 years ago |
peter
|
63cf4464d3
* tvarsym.varregable added, split vo_regable from varoptions
|
21 years ago |
peter
|
ba87da9bc2
* fix compile for oldregvars
|
21 years ago |
peter
|
8fb3536f6e
* simple regvar support, not yet finished
|
21 years ago |
peter
|
65c3ba277c
* ungetregister is now only used for cpuregisters, renamed to
|
21 years ago |
peter
|
33a834821f
* paraloc branch merged
|
21 years ago |
peter
|
7f8844e74d
* release localsymtables when module is compiled
|
21 years ago |
peter
|
180c042911
* finalize all (also procedure local) typedconst at unit finalization
|
21 years ago |
michael
|
dd042a896b
+ Patch from Peter to fix debuginfo in constructor.
|
21 years ago |
Jonas Maebe
|
5ac21c998a
* don't finalize typed consts (fixes bug3212, but causes memory leak;
|
21 years ago |
Jonas Maebe
|
f1bda1700a
* support register parameters for inlined procedures + some inline
|
21 years ago |
Jonas Maebe
|
1f990337c3
* fixed one regvar problem, but regvars are still broken since the dwarf
|
21 years ago |